Lines Matching refs:test_program
171 const model::test_program_ptr test_program; member
182 test_program(test_program_), test_case_name(test_case_name_) in exec_data()
229 const model::test_case& test_case = test_program->find(test_case_name); in test_exec_data()
295 static model::test_program
296 force_absolute_paths(const model::test_program program) in force_absolute_paths()
304 return model::test_program( in force_absolute_paths()
318 const model::test_program _test_program;
331 const model::test_program* test_program, in list_test_cases() argument
334 _test_program(force_absolute_paths(*test_program)), in list_test_cases()
356 const model::test_program _test_program;
415 const model::test_program_ptr test_program, in run_test_program() argument
419 _test_program(force_absolute_paths(*test_program)), in run_test_program()
453 const model::test_program _test_program;
470 const model::test_program_ptr test_program, in run_test_cleanup() argument
474 _test_program(force_absolute_paths(*test_program)), in run_test_cleanup()
514 const model::test_program& /* test_program */, in exec_cleanup() argument
569 test_program(interface_name_, binary_, root_, test_suite_name_, md_, in lazy_test_program()
599 return test_program::test_cases(); in test_cases()
730 model::test_program_ptr test_program; member
746 test_program(test_program_), in impl()
775 scheduler::test_result_handle::test_program(void) const in test_program() function in scheduler::test_result_handle
777 return _pimpl->test_program; in test_program()
834 % test_data->test_program->relative_path() in ~impl()
882 test_data->test_program, test_data->test_case_name, in sync_cleanup()
900 spawn_cleanup(const model::test_program_ptr test_program, in spawn_cleanup()
909 find_interface(test_program->interface_name()); in spawn_cleanup()
911 LI(F("Spawning %s:%s (cleanup)") % test_program->absolute_path() % in spawn_cleanup()
915 run_test_cleanup(interface, test_program, test_case_name, in spawn_cleanup()
920 test_program, test_case_name, body_handle, body_result)); in spawn_cleanup()
1037 const model::test_program* test_program, in list_tests() argument
1043 test_program->interface_name()); in list_tests()
1047 list_test_cases(interface, test_program, user_config), in list_tests()
1091 const model::test_program_ptr test_program, in spawn_test() argument
1098 test_program->interface_name()); in spawn_test()
1100 LI(F("Spawning %s:%s") % test_program->absolute_path() % test_case_name); in spawn_test()
1102 const model::test_case& test_case = test_program->find(test_case_name); in spawn_test()
1112 run_test_program(interface, test_program, test_case_name, in spawn_test()
1118 test_program, test_case_name, interface, user_config)); in spawn_test()
1149 utils::dump_stacktrace_if_available(data->test_program->absolute_path(), in wait_any()
1160 const model::test_case& test_case = test_data->test_program->find( in wait_any()
1209 _pimpl->spawn_cleanup(test_data->test_program, in wait_any()
1267 data->test_program, data->test_case_name, result.get())); in wait_any()
1286 const model::test_program_ptr test_program, in debug_test() argument
1293 test_program, test_case_name, user_config); in debug_test()